About the position Our client in the industrial energy sector is seeking entry-level Electrical Engineers near Houston, TX. This is an excellent opportunity for Electrical Engineering graduates who want to learn how Power Distribution Centers (PDCs) / E-Houses, along with their components, are designed and manufactured. You will receive hands-on training, gradually taking on responsibilities across design, documentation, and shop support while working with experienced engineers and designers. This is a great opportunity to start your career with a growing company that values collaboration, technical excellence, and professional growth. Responsibilities • Support power distribution equipment projects • Learn PDC/E-House design fundamentals through training • Assist with equipment layouts, single-line diagrams, and simple wiring diagrams • Draft in AutoCAD with templates and guidance • Perform basic engineering calculations (load, voltage drop, equipment sizing) • Help create bills of materials (BOMs) for internal and client use • Participate in code, standards, and constructability reviews with senior team members • Review vendor documentation and capture relevant technical information • Coordinate activities with engineers, designers, and project managers • Provide shop support by shadowing builds and logging issues • Collaborate across engineering, production, and quality teams Requirements •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ering is required • Strong willingness to learn power distribution equipment design is required • Basic AutoCAD drafting proficiency required • Good communication skills and the ability to work in a collaborative environment are required • Ability to work on-site Monday- Thursday is required (Fridays: work from home option available) Benefits • Medical • Dental • Vision • 401k (3% match) • Vacation • Generous Holidays Apply tot his job
